About this House

Henderson!!! 4 bedrooms!!! Community Pool!!! Gated. Playground!!! Patio in back yard. Home includes Living room with entertainment center and tile floors. Dining room with tile floors. Kitchen: Recessed Lighting, Pantry, Tile floors, stainless steel sink and Microwave. Staircase with Pot shelving. Primary bedroom; French doors, ceiling fan and light fixture. Primary bath; Roman tub and shower combo. 7x4 Walk in Closet and tile floors. Laundry room upstairs. Overhead Storage shelves in Garage.
228 Priority Point St, Henderson, NV 89012 is a 4 bedroom, 3 bathroom, 1,738 sqft townhouse in McCullough Hills, built in 2004. It last sold for $370,000 on May 15, 2026 (1% below the $375,000 asking price). More recently, it was listed as a rental in August 2023 with an asking price of $2,200 per month. That rental listing was removed on August 17, 2023. It is currently off market. The Trulia Estimate is $370,600, with a rent estimate of $2,387/month.

  • remerson13
    "We’ve lived in the Horizon Terrace neighborhood for almost four years and we love it!! It’s a small enough neighborhood that everyone gets to know their neighbor. On Halloween the entire community is out walking or sitting in their driveway waiting to hand out candy and say hello. This community is located i n the base of the mountain so it is quiet and has incredible views of the Vegas Valley. There are also amazing hiking trails right in your back yard. Henderson living at its finest!!! "
